InStyle's editorial guidelines Published on January 27, 2014 @ 07:19AM Pin Share Tweet Email Photo: Landov; AP; WIreImage The 2014 Grammy Awards brought a medley of braids to the red carpet as a top hair trend of the night. As a nod to one of our favorite girls on fire (second to Alicia Keys, of course), Sara Bareilles used Katniss Everdeen as inspiration for the tiny twists in her boho-chic waves, while Katy Perry and Colbie Caillat each took the updo route. Perry opted for an oversized knot, and we especially loved how Caillat gave her look extra drama by adding a plait that started at the nape of her neck, and was wound into a ballerina bun. Eager to try your hand at Caillat's embellished updo? The star's hairstylist Torsten Witte began by blowing out her damp strands with a T3 Featherweight Luxe Dryer ($250; t3mircro.com), then locked in the sleek texture with the brand's SinglePass Flat Iron ($160; t3micro.com) before starting on the braid. Taking a section of hair at the nape of her neck, Witte began twisting under her right ear, and continued until he reached the top of her head. Once he secured the plait with an elastic, he pulled the remaining hair and the twist into a ponytail, then wound the entire length around the base to form a loose top knot. A few hair pins and a spritz of hairspray anchored the style, and kept it in place all night. We love it! Get even more Grammy style inspiration by checking out what everyone wore in our gallery.
